
Star Trek Meets Monty Python


International Space Station (NASA, March 2009)

International Space Station (NASA, March 2009)
Originally uploaded by nasa1fan/MSFC

Hi everyone -- I came across this image as part of something else I was working on today, and I thought it was too good not to share. An image of the backlit International Space Station, taken in March of 2009. Enjoy!